    As the admin, I am now able to receive the messages that web visitors send through the contact us page.

    Before, I would get the message (when testing), that everything worked fine and the message was sent successfully, but the email never arrived, not even in the spam folder.

    I set up SPF and DKIM entries in DNS, waited 48 hours for DNS to propagate, played with and double checked captcha settings and tried creating alias email addresses as indicated im the FAQ.

    But I still would not receive the Messages website visitors would send.

    That is until I installed FluentSMTP, and hooked it into a free, Send-in-Blue account.

    As I said, I don’t think I should’ve had to jump through all these hoops, but at least it’s working, and it’s working really reliably. Because I’ve even sent some really spammy looking messages as a test, and they still came to me.

    It apparently wasn’t with MIME types.

    I added SSL and was on a SNI installation (no static IP for the SSL), which worked for some browsers and not others.

    I got a dedicated IP, and forced SSL on all pages of the site, and all downloads are no longer renaming the file types…
